Lentil Salad
Recipe by Julie @ Julie's Creative Lifestyle
This is an easy and healthy salad using lentils. It's perfect for any summer BBQ or gathering.
Prep time: 15 minutesTotal time: 15 minutes
Ingredients
- 1 package Steamed Lentils - Trader Joe's
- 5 small carrots - chopped
- 2 celery stalks - chopped
- 1/4 cup red onion - chopped
- 6 tablespoons red wine vinegar
- 6 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 pinch salt
- 1 pinch pepper
- 1 sprinkle Mrs. Dash Original Blend Seasoning
- Add steamed lentils to a large bowl and mix up. Add carrots, celery, red onion and mix everything all together. In another small bowl mix the vinegar, olive oil, and seasonings together and add that to the lentils and vegetables. Mix well and refrigerate before serving.
